Why academic papers are hard to understand


Most academic papers are linear. They are designed to be read page by page: introduction, literature review, methodology, results, discussion, and conclusion.

But understanding is not always linear.


One concept in the introduction may depend on a theory explained later. A method may only make sense if you understand a previous framework. A result may connect to an argument hidden in the literature review. A term may be used several times in different contexts.

When you only read the paper as a PDF, these relationships can stay hidden.

That is the problem: you may collect information, but still miss the bigger picture.


What is a concept map?


A concept map is a visual structure that shows how ideas connect.

Instead of seeing a paper as pages of text, you see it as a network of concepts, arguments, definitions, methods, results, and relationships. This makes the paper easier to understand because you can see how each part contributes to the main idea.


For academic reading, a concept map helps you answer important questions:

  • What is the main argument?

  • Which concepts are essential?

  • Which ideas depend on each other?

  • What are the key definitions?

  • How does the methodology connect to the conclusion?

  • What should I remember for an exam, essay, or research project?
